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: 1. Age 28 days to 16 years old; 2. Clinical or laboratory diagnosis of Gram-positive bacterial infection; 3. Use vancomycin for >= 72 hours and monitor the serum trough and peak concentrations of vancomycin; 4. The informed consent has been signed.
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: 1. Those who have received teicoplanin, linezolid, rifampicin and other antibacterial drugs for more than 24 hours within 72 hours before treatment; 2. The time of using vancomycin is less than 72h; 3. Intravenous use of vancomycin; 4. Carry out blood purification treatment; 5. Combined use of other nephrotoxic drugs, such as aminoglycosides, amphotericin and cyclosporine; 6. Incomplete clinical data; 7. Vancomycin is resistant, allergic, or has stopped taking drugs due to adverse reactions during use; 8. Abnormal hearing.
